A Victorian Emolline blue button pot lid, complete with an original glass bottle. An early variation of this blue ironstone chemist lid with cross shaded ‘EMOLLINE’ typography, it does not feature the Tavern street address like later examples. Instead, arched typography for Cornell & Cornell is inside a wide double pinstripe border, which surrounds classical scrolling details and only the name of the town of manufacture - Ipswich.
